Google
 

Trailing-Edge - PDP-10 Archives - BB-T573C-DD_1986 - 35,1414/pkintb.ctl
There is 1 other file named pkintb.ctl in the archive. Click here to see a list.
;PKINTB.CTL[35,1414] 20 DEC 1982 T. IACOBONE
;
;BATCH CONTROL FILE SUBMITTED FROM ACCINT.MIC
;
;THIS CONTROL FILE WILL SCAN FOR THE EXISTANCE OF RP06 AND/OR RP07
;DRIVES BUILT INTO THE TOPS10 MONITOR. IT IS ASSUMED THAT THE KLAD
;IS MOUNTED ON RPA0.
;
;***WARNING IF YOU DO NOT WISH TO FORMAT A DRIVE LEAVE IT CYCLED DOWN
;   OR DO NOT RUN THIS CONTROL FILE
;
.DAYTIME
;
;
RPB0::
;IS THIS DRIVE IN THE SYSTEM ?
.ERROR ?
.DIR RPB0:[1,1]
.IF (ERROR) .GOTO RPC
.ERROR ??
;
;MAKE SURE PACK IS ON LINE
;
.OPERATOR
;
.RU TESTRP[35,1414]
RPB0
;
.NOOPERATOR
.IF (ERROR) .GOTO RPB1
;
;IF ERROR PACK NOT TO BE TESTED GO CHECK NEXT DRIVE
;
.ERROR #
;
;WHAT KIND OF DRIVE IS IT
;
.RU TESTRP[35,1414]
RPB0
;
.IF (NOERROR) .GOTO R7B0
.SUB RPB0FM[35,1414]/TIME/UNIQ:0/PRIOR:5
;
;UPDATE THE MOUNT COMMAND FILE
.ERROR
.TECO MOUNT.CMD
*IRECOGNIZE RPB0:
^[^[
*EX^[^[
;
.TECO MODIFY.CMD
*IMODIFY ACTIVE-SWAPPING-LIST INCLUDE RPB0:
^[^[
*EX^[^[
.GOTO RPB1
;
R7B0::
.SUB R7B0FM[35,1414]/TIME/UNIQ:0/PRIOR:5
;
;
;UPDATE THE MOUNT COMMAND FILE
.ERROR
.TECO MOUNT.CMD
*IRECOGNIZE RPB0:
^[^[
*EX^[^[
;
.TECO MODIFY.CMD
*IMODIFY ACTIVE-SWAPPING-LIST INCLUDE RPB0:
^[^[
*EX^[^[
RPB1::
;IS THIS DRIVE IN THE SYSTEM ?
.ERROR ?
.DIR RPB1:[1,1]
.IF (ERROR) .GOTO RPC
.ERROR ??
;
;MAKE SURE PACK IS ON LINE
;
.OPERATOR
;
.RU TESTRP[35,1414]
RPB1
;
.NOOPERATOR
.IF (ERROR) .GOTO RPB2
;
;IF ERROR PACK NOT TO BE TESTED GO CHECK NEXT DRIVE
;
.ERROR #
;
;WHAT KIND OF DRIVE IS IT
;
.RU TESTRP[35,1414]
RPB1
;
.IF (NOERROR) .GOTO R7B1
.SUB RPB1FM[35,1414]/TIME/UNIQ:0/PRIOR:5
;
;UPDATE THE MOUNT COMMAND FILE
.ERROR
.TECO MOUNT.CMD
*IRECOGNIZE RPB1:
^[^[
*EX^[^[
;
.TECO MODIFY.CMD
*IMODIFY ACTIVE-SWAPPING-LIST INCLUDE RPB1:
^[^[
*EX^[^[
;
.GOTO RPB2
;
R7B1::
.SUB R7B1FM[35,1414]/TIME/UNIQ:0/PRIOR:5
;
;
;UPDATE THE MOUNT COMMAND FILE
.ERROR
.TECO MOUNT.CMD
*IRECOGNIZE RPB1:
^[^[
*EX^[^[
;
.TECO MODIFY.CMD
*IMODIFY ACTIVE-SWAPPING-LIST INCLUDE RPB1:
^[^[
*EX^[^[
;
RPB2::
;IS THIS DRIVE IN THE SYSTEM ?
.ERROR ?
.DIR RPB2:[1,1]
.IF (ERROR) .GOTO RPC
;MAKE SURE PACK IS ON LINE
.ERROR ??
.OPERATOR
;
.RU TESTRP[35,1414]
RPB2
;
.NOOPERATOR
.IF (ERROR) .GOTO RPB3
;
;IF ERROR PACK NOT TO BE TESTED GO CHECK NEXT DRIVE
;
.ERROR #
;
;WHAT KIND OF DRIVE IS IT
;
.RU TESTRP[35,1414]
RPB2
;
.IF (NOERROR) .GOTO R7B2
.SUB RPB2FM[35,1414]/TIME/UNIQ:0/PRIOR:5
;
;UPDATE THE MOUNT COMMAND FILE
.ERROR
.TECO MOUNT.CMD
*IRECOGNIZE RPB2:
^[^[
*EX^[^[
;
.TECO MODIFY.CMD
*IMODIFY ACTIVE-SWAPPING-LIST INCLUDE RPB2:
^[^[
*EX^[^[
;
.GOTO RPB3
;
R7B2::
.SUB R7B2FM[35,1414]/TIME/UNIQ:0/PRIOR:5
;;
;UPDATE THE MOUNT COMMAND FILE
.ERROR
.TECO MOUNT.CMD
*IRECOGNIZE RPB2:
^[^[
*EX^[^[
;
.TECO MODIFY.CMD
*IMODIFY ACTIVE-SWAPPING-LIST INCLUDE RPB2:
^[^[
*EX^[^[
;

RPB3::
;IS THIS DRIVE IN THE SYSTEM ?
.ERROR ?
.DIR RPB3:[1,1]
.IF (ERROR) .GOTO RPC
;MAKE SURE PACK IS ON LINE
.ERROR ??
.OPERATOR
;
.RU TESTRP[35,1414]
RPB3
;
.NOOPERATOR
.IF (ERROR) .GOTO RPB4
;
;IF ERROR PACK NOT TO BE TESTED GO CHECK NEXT DRIVE
;
.ERROR #
;
;WHAT KIND OF DRIVE IS IT
;
.RU TESTRP[35,1414]
RPB3
;
.IF (NOERROR) .GOTO R7B3
.SUB RPB3FM[35,1414]/TIME/UNIQ:0/PRIOR:5
;
;UPDATE THE MOUNT COMMAND FILE
.ERROR
.TECO MOUNT.CMD
*IRECOGNIZE RPB3:
^[^[
*EX^[^[
;
.TECO MODIFY.CMD
*IMODIFY ACTIVE-SWAPPING-LIST INCLUDE RPB3:
^[^[
*EX^[^[
;
.GOTO RPB4
;
R7B3::
.SUB R7B3FM[35,1414]/TIME/UNIQ:0/PRIOR:5
;
;UPDATE THE MOUNT COMMAND FILE
.ERROR
.TECO MOUNT.CMD
*IRECOGNIZE RPB3:
^[^[
*EX^[^[
;
.TECO MODIFY.CMD
*IMODIFY ACTIVE-SWAPPING-LIST INCLUDE RPB3:
^[^[
*EX^[^[
;
;
RPB4::
;
;IS THIS DRIVE IN THE SYSTEM ?
.ERROR ?
.DIR RPB4:[1,1]
.IF (ERROR) .GOTO RPC
;MAKE SURE PACK IS ON LINE
.ERROR ??
.OPERATOR
;
.RU TESTRP[35,1414]
RPB4
;
.NOOPERATOR
.IF (ERROR) .GOTO RPB5
;
;IF ERROR PACK NOT TO BE TESTED GO CHECK NEXT DRIVE
;
.ERROR #
;
;WHAT KIND OF DRIVE IS IT
;
.RU TESTRP[35,1414]
RPB4
;
.IF (NOERROR) .GOTO R7B4
.SUB RPB4FM[35,1414]/TIME/UNIQ:0/PRIOR:5
.GOTO RPB5
;
;UPDATE THE MOUNT COMMAND FILE
.ERROR
.TECO MOUNT.CMD
*IRECOGNIZE RPB4:
^[^[
*EX^[^[
;
.TECO MODIFY.CMD
*IMODIFY ACTIVE-SWAPPING-LIST INCLUDE RPB4:
^[^[
*EX^[^[
;
;
R7B4::
.SUB R7B4FM[35,1414]/TIME/UNIQ:0/PRIOR:5
;
;UPDATE THE MOUNT COMMAND FILE
.ERROR
.TECO MOUNT.CMD
*IRECOGNIZE RPB4:
^[^[
*EX^[^[
;
.TECO MODIFY.CMD
*IMODIFY ACTIVE-SWAPPING-LIST INCLUDE RPB4:
^[^[
*EX^[^[
;
RPB5::
;
;IS THIS DRIVE IN THE SYSTEM ?
.ERROR ?
.DIR RPB5:[1,1]
.IF (ERROR) .GOTO RPC
;MAKE SURE PACK IS ON LINE
.ERROR ??
.OPERATOR
;
.RU TESTRP[35,1414]
RPB5
;
.NOOPERATOR
.IF (ERROR) .GOTO RPB6
;
;IF ERROR PACK NOT TO BE TESTED GO CHECK NEXT DRIVE
;
.ERROR #
;
;WHAT KIND OF DRIVE IS IT
;
.RU TESTRP[35,1414]
RPB5
;
.IF (NOERROR) .GOTO R7B5
.SUB RPB5FM[35,1414]/TIME/UNIQ:0/PRIOR:5
.GOTO RPB6
;
;UPDATE THE MOUNT COMMAND FILE
.ERROR
.TECO MOUNT.CMD
*IRECOGNIZE RPB5:
^[^[
*EX^[^[
;
.TECO MODIFY.CMD
*IMODIFY ACTIVE-SWAPPING-LIST INCLUDE RPB5:
^[^[
*EX^[^[
;
;
R7B5::
.SUB R7B5FM[35,1414]/TIME/UNIQ:0/PRIOR:5
;
;UPDATE THE MOUNT COMMAND FILE
.ERROR
.TECO MOUNT.CMD
*IRECOGNIZE RPB5:
^[^[
*EX^[^[
;
;
.TECO MODIFY.CMD
*IMODIFY ACTIVE-SWAPPING-LIST INCLUDE RPB5:
^[^[
*EX^[^[
;
RPB6::
;
;IS THIS DRIVE IN THE SYSTEM ?
.ERROR ?
.DIR RPB6:[1,1]
.IF (ERROR) .GOTO RPC
;MAKE SURE PACK IS ON LINE
.ERROR ??
.OPERATOR
;
.RU TESTRP[35,1414]
RPB6
;
.NOOPERATOR
.IF (ERROR) .GOTO RPB7
;
;IF ERROR PACK NOT TO BE TESTED GO CHECK NEXT DRIVE
;
.ERROR #
;
;WHAT KIND OF DRIVE IS IT
;
.RU TESTRP[35,1414]
RPB6
;
.IF (NOERROR) .GOTO R7B6
.SUB RPB6FM[35,1414]/TIME/UNIQ:0/PRIOR:5
.GOTO RPB7
;
;UPDATE THE MOUNT COMMAND FILE
.ERROR
.TECO MOUNT.CMD
*IRECOGNIZE RPB6:
^[^[
*EX^[^[
;
.TECO MODIFY.CMD
*IMODIFY ACTIVE-SWAPPING-LIST INCLUDE RPB6:
^[^[
*EX^[^[
;
;
R7B6::
.SUB R7B6FM[35,1414]/TIME/UNIQ:0/PRIOR:5
;
;UPDATE THE MOUNT COMMAND FILE
.ERROR
.TECO MOUNT.CMD
*IRECOGNIZE RPB6:
^[^[
*EX^[^[
;
.TECO MODIFY.CMD
*IMODIFY ACTIVE-SWAPPING-LIST INCLUDE RPB6:
^[^[
*EX^[^[
;
;
RPB7::
;
;IS THIS DRIVE IN THE SYSTEM ?
.ERROR ?
.DIR RPB7:[1,1]
.IF (ERROR) .GOTO RPC
;MAKE SURE PACK IS ON LINE
.ERROR ??
.OPERATOR
;
.RU TESTRP[35,1414]
RPB7
;
.NOOPERATOR
.IF (ERROR) .GOTO RPC
;
;IF ERROR PACK NOT TO BE TESTED GO CHECK NEXT DRIVE
;
.ERROR #
;
;WHAT KIND OF DRIVE IS IT
;
.RU TESTRP[35,1414]
RPB7
;
.IF (NOERROR) .GOTO R7B7
.SUB RPB7FM[35,1414]/TIME/UNIQ:0/PRIOR:5
.GOTO RPC
;
;UPDATE THE MOUNT COMMAND FILE
.ERROR
.TECO MOUNT.CMD
*IRECOGNIZE RPB7:
^[^[
*EX^[^[
;
.TECO MODIFY.CMD
*IMODIFY ACTIVE-SWAPPING-LIST INCLUDE RPB7:
^[^[
*EX^[^[
;
;
R7B7::
.SUB R7B7FM[35,1414]/TIME/UNIQ:0/PRIOR:5
;
;UPDATE THE MOUNT COMMAND FILE
.ERROR
.TECO MOUNT.CMD
*IRECOGNIZE RPB7:
^[^[
*EX^[^[
;
.TECO MODIFY.CMD
*IMODIFY ACTIVE-SWAPPING-LIST INCLUDE RPB7:
^[^[
*EX^[^[
;
RPC::
;
;GO SEE IF THERE ARE ANY MORE TO BE CHECKED
;
.ERROR ?
.DIR RPC:[1,1]
.IF (ERROR) .GOTO DONE::
;YES
.SUB PKINTC[35,1414]/TIME/UNIQ:0/PRIOR:5
.GOTO DONE
%ERR::
.PLEASE ***ERROR IN PKINTB.CTL***^[
%CERR::
.PLEASE ***ERROR IN PKINTB.CTL***^[
DONE::
%FIN::